Abstract

Several multicast key management schemes such as those proposed by Wallner et al and Wong et al are based on a multilevel, logical hierarchy (or tree) of key-encrypting keys. When used in conjunction with a reliable multicast infrastructure, this approach results in a highly efficient key update mechanism in which the number of multicast messages transmitted upon a membership update is proportional to the depth of the tree,which is logarithmic to the size of the secure multicast group. But this is based on the hypothesis that the tree is maintained in a balanced manner. This paper proposes a scalable rekeying scheme-link-tree structure for implementing secure group communication. Theoretical calculation and experimentation show that this scheme has better performance than the tree structure and the star structure, and at the same time still keep the link-tree structure balanced.
